Definition

Quick Definition(Strong's Concordance)

properly, to use up, i.e. destroy

from G303 (ἀνά) and a form of the alternate of G138 (αἱρέομαι);

Full Lexicon Entry(Abbott-Smith)
1.to expend.
2.to consume, destroy
LXX: chiefly for אָכַל also for כָּלָה, etc.
